Conclusion

Rarely do we get a product which can be summarised so simply. Without a mass of features on board or things to weigh the pros and cons of, the Cooler Master MM731 is one of those mice which almost sells itself.

Do you want a mouse which is designed for larger hands and lengthy gaming sessions, all curvy and smooth rather than multiple textures, indents, creases and buttons? It has you covered. Would you prefer it if your mouse didn’t sit on your pad looking like Oxford Street at Christmas? Tick in the box. Are you tired of having ten different buttons fighting for space and would instead rather have – or perhaps need for physical limitation reasons – just a couple of really obvious buttons? The MM731 is all about making you happy. Would you like your mouse to have all the blazing sensor abilities of a high end modern mouse, ensuring that the accuracy and DPI of your sensor isn’t the limiting factor in your gaming exploits? The 19000 DPI PixArt sensor lives to serve.

That’s it really. If the answer to the above questions is no, then naturally there are dozens of mice on the market that will wow you with an enormous feature list. But when the answer is yes, those options shrink rapidly. One would imagine that these days it would be simplicity itself to have a mouse which is like the old days, just with modern hardware under the hood, but not so. Thankfully the Cooler Master MM731 redresses that balance. Unfortunately the one thing it has learnt from its contemporaries is that high end sensors and wireless connectivity options come with a beefy price tag, so perhaps it’s harder to justify on a scale of price vs features.

However, if you are a fan of simplicity, of unity of purpose, then little else will scratch that itch quite like the Cooler Master MM731. It is very light without having to resort to cutting holes in the case, it has a hugely capable sensor and is extremely comfortable, thus it wins our OC3D Gamers Choice Award.
